PROP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

94 of the 7,640 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Prairie Operating Co (PROP)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$16M — down 13% from $18.4M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 28 funds opened new PROP positions and 14 closed out — a net gain of 14 holders — while 35 added to existing stakes and 17 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Marshall Wace, adding an estimated $1.42M. The largest seller was Hodges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$300K sold.
